AutoCAD 2009. Учебный курс
Шрифт:
По умолчанию в список включены имя атрибута, подсказка, значение по умолчанию, а также режимы вставки и отображения атрибута. С помощью кнопки Settings… можно задать свойства атрибута, которые должны быть показаны в списке. Нажатие кнопки Edit… загружает диалоговое окно редактирования атрибута Edit Attribute.
Допускается извлечение данных из рисунка с помощью команды EATTEXT , которая загружает Мастер извлечения данных Data Extraction.
Результаты выполнения запросов на извлечение данных из рисунка сохраняются в таблице текущего файла формата DWG или в отдельном текстовом файле формата ASCII, который впоследствии может быть передан в какую-либо систему управления базами данных. Извлечение данных никак не влияет на рисунок. Записи в файле разделяются запятыми или знаками табуляции. Кроме того, пользователь может формировать результаты в формате Microsoft Excel или Access.
Мастер извлечения данных – удобное средство создания различных спецификаций и отчетов, оперирующее данными, получаемыми непосредственно из рисунков. Например, можно создать рисунок, где каждый блок представляет определенное производственное оборудование. Если с каждым таким блоком связаны атрибуты, идентифицирующие модель и производителя оборудования, то можно автоматизировать подготовку различных отчетов о составе и общей стоимости имеющегося оборудования.
На первой странице Мастера извлечения данных Data Extraction – Begin (рис. 10.29) настраиваются следующие параметры:
• Create a new data extraction – новое извлечение данных;
• Use previous extraction as a template (.dxe or .blk) – использование шаблона (расписание, список деталей и т. д.);
• Edit an existing data extraction – редактирование существующих извлеченных данных.
Для использования ранее сохраненных параметров необходимо выбрать вариант использования шаблона.
На второй странице Мастера извлечения данных Data Extraction – Define Data Source (рис. 10.30) осуществляется определение источника данных.
• В области Data source определяются параметры источника данных:
– Drawings/Sheet set – выбор чертежей/подшивок;
– Include current drawing – включение текущего чертежа;
– Select objects in the current drawing – выбор объектов в текущем чертеже.
• В области Drawing files and folders: – показаны файлы чертежей.
• Кнопка Add Folder … загружает диалоговое окно дополнительных настроек Add Folder Options (рис. 10.31), где настраиваются следующие параметры:
– Folder – определение папки;
– в области Options определяются параметры:
· Automatically include new drawings added in this folder to the data extractions – автоматическое включение новых чертежей, добавленных в папку к извлеченным данным;
· Include subfolders – включение внутренних папок;
· Utilize wild-card characters to select drawings – использование кода для выбора чертежей.
На третьей странице Мастера извлечения данных Data Extraction—Select Objects (рис. 10.32) осуществляется выбор объектов. Здесь необходимо выбрать объекты, которые требуется включить как заголовки столбцов и строк в конечном файле.
Для отображения списка дополнительных параметров следует щелкнуть правой кнопкой мыши на элементе в списке. Если необходимо, можно указать другое имя, которое будет отображаться в заголовках столбцов выводимых данных. В этом диалоговом окне настраиваются следующие параметры.
• В области Objects перечислены объекты и выводимые имена.
• В области Display options настраиваются параметры экрана:
– Display all object types – отображение объектов всех типов;
– Display blocks only – отображение только блоков;
– Display non-blocks only – отображение объектов, не являющихся блоками;
– Display blocks with attributes only – отображение только блоков с атрибутами;
– Display objects currently in-use only – отображение только текущих используемых объектов.
На странице 4 Мастера извлечения данных Data Extraction—Select Properties (рис. 10.33) осуществляется выбор свойств. В окне просмотра можно изменить порядок элементов в таблице с помощью перетаскивания. Для того чтобы отсортировать данные, следует щелкнуть на заголовке столбца.
Для доступа к дополнительным параметрам необходимо щелкнуть правой кнопкой мыши на заголовке столбца. При этом открывается контекстное меню (рис. 10.34):
• Check All – выбор всех элементов;
• Uncheck All – отмена всего выбора;
• Invert Selection – замена выбора на обратный;
• Edit Display Name – редактирование выводимых имен.
На странице 5 Мастера извлечения данных Data Extraction—Refine Data (рис. 10.35) осуществляется упорядочение и сортировка колонок, настройка фильтров, добавление колонок с формулами, а также создание связей с внешними данными:
• Combine identical rows – объединение рядов;
• Show count column – отображение номера столбца;
• Show name column – отображение имени столбца;
• кнопка Link External Data… загружает одноименное диалоговое окно описания связей с внешними данными;
• кнопка Sort Columns Options… загружает диалоговое окно сортировки столбцов Sort Columns;
• кнопка Full Preview… загружает диалоговое окно предварительного просмотра Data Extraction—Full Preview.
На странице 6 Мастера извлечения данных Data Extraction—Choose Output (рис. 10.36) осуществляется размещение данных:
• Insert data extraction table into drawing – вставка извлеченных данных таблицы в чертеж;
• Output data to external file (.xls .csv .mdb .txt) – размещение данных во внешнем файле.
На странице 7 Мастера извлечения данных Data Extraction—Table Style (рис. 10.37) создается стиль таблицы.
• Select the table style to use for the inserted table – выбор стиля таблицы.
• В области Formating and structure осуществляется форматирование:
– Use table in table style for label rows – использование табличного стиля для названия рядов;
– Manually setup table – формирование таблицы вручную;
– Enter a title for your table: – ввод заголовка таблицы;
– Tile cell style: – название ячейки;
– Header cell style: – заголовок ячейки;
– Data cell style: – содержимое ячейки.
На странице 8 Мастера извлечения данных Data Extraction—Finish (рис. 10.38) завершается работа с Мастером. Для извлечения данных необходимо нажать кнопку Finish. Если выбрано извлечение в таблицу, то после нажатия кнопки Finish появится запрос точки вставки. Если выбрано извлечение во внешний файл, то произойдет создание файла.
Таблицы
Команда TABLE осуществляет создание пустой таблицы объектов в чертеже. Вызывается команда из падающего меню Draw → Table.. . или щелчком на пиктограмме Table… на панели инструментов Draw. В результате открывается диалоговое окно вставки таблицы Insert Table – рис. 10.39.
Рис. 10.39. Диалоговое окно вставки таблицы
Таблица представляет собой прямоугольную структуру ячеек, организованных по строкам и столбцам, в которых содержатся текстовые объекты или блоки.
Перед заполнением ячеек информацией создается пустая таблица.
В диалоговом окне Insert Table настраиваются следующие параметры.
• В области Table style определяется стиль таблицы.
• В области Insert options – параметры вставки.
• В области Insertion behavior определяется способ вставки:
– Specify insertion point – запрос точки вставки;
– Specify window – запрос занимаемой области.
• В области Column & row settings задаются параметры строк и столбцов:
– Columns: – количество столбцов;
– Column width: – ширина столбца;
– Data rows: – количество строк;
– Row height: – высота строки.
• В области Set cell styles устанавливаются стили ячеек.
После создания таблицы можно вводить текст или добавлять блоки в ячейки. Для редактирования размеров таблицы достаточно указать с помощью мыши любую линию сетки, а затем изменить их с помощью ручек или палитры свойств. При этом строки и столбцы меняются пропорционально.
Чтобы выделить ячейку, следует указать точку внутри ее. Ручки появляются на середине каждой границы ячейки. С помощью ручек можно изменить ширину и высоту ячейки и, соответственно, ширину и высоту ее столбца и строки.
Чтобы выделить несколько ячеек, следует выбрать одну из них, а затем, удерживая нажатой кнопку мыши, указать все остальные ячейки.
Контекстное меню таблицы (рис. 10.40) вызывается щелчком правой кнопки мыши при выделенной ячейке. Оно позволяет вставлять и удалять столбцы и строки, комбинировать смежные ячейки и пр.
• Cut – вырезать.
• Copy – копировать.
• Paste – вставить.
• Recent Input – последний ввод.
• Cell Style – стиль ячеек.
• Alignment – выравнивание: Top Left – вверх влево; Top Center – вверх по центру; Top Right – вверх вправо; Middle Left – середина влево; Middle Center – середина по центру; Middle Right – середина вправо; Bottom Left – вниз влево; Bottom Center – вниз по центру; Bottom Right – вниз вправо.
• Borders… – загрузка диалогового окна определения свойств границ ячеек Cell Border Properties (рис. 10.41), в котором определяются свойства границ: Lineweight: – вес линий; Linetype: – тип линий; Color: – цвет.
• Data Format… – загрузка диалогового окна определения формата ячейки таблицы Table Cell Format.
• Match Cell – установка формата по образцу.
• Remove All Property Overrides – снятие переопределения свойств.
• Data Link… – загрузка диалогового окна Select a Data Link.
• Insert – вставка:
– Block… – загрузка диалогового окна Insert a Block in a Table Cell (рис. 10.42), предназначенного для вставки блока в ячейку таблицы: